PANEL DISCUSSION ON CFD AND STRUCTURES APPLICATION REQUIREMENTS • Many of the panel members are now in the process of addressing complicated multi-physics problems be it for ship, rotorcraft, or fixed wing aircraft design. • What are the most significant algorithmic issues in this area that need to be addressed?
PANEL DISCUSSION ON CFD AND STRUCTURES APPLICATION REQUIREMENTS • Most current high performance computers now consist of 100s or 1000s of SMP nodes with multicore chips. • How do current algorithms map to this computer paradigm? • Does it make your development work easier or harder? • What kind of HPC architectural improvements are needed to efficiently support these algorithms?
PANEL DISCUSSION ON CFD AND STRUCTURES APPLICATION REQUIREMENTS • What changes in computer programming models for HPC systems would benefit work in this area?
